As far as cloth diapers go we have only tried the BumGenius and the gDiapers. I liked the gDiapers, but they are size specific, whereas the BumGenius are one-size-fits-all. If you are thinking about getting them I would strongly advise you to be extremely careful with washing them. Someone (will not name names lol) dried our white ones with a drier sheet and ever since they are not as waterproof : ( It is more work to do cloth diapers, but I feel it is worth it when you realize how much money you save over time. I also really feel that it helped Nigel with potty training. He was ready to tackle the potty before he was 2!
